    Had another look at this and I will try to be as brief as possible.
    I forgot to point out in my first comment that I had auto add/delete points selected and with that selected the pen tool autmatically shows the delete point tool when the tool is over a point. Clicking would then remove the point and the path direction will be modified. It is not possible to remove a point from a bezier path without modifying the paths direction, or to remove an end point from a path, this is the mathmatical law involved. If you need a gap in the path, place a new point either side of the required gap the delete the path between them. T modify the end of a path, ie. shorten it, you will still need to place a point where you desire the path to end. If as you suggest the whole path is deleted I can only imagine you may be accidentaly double deleting, as the whole of the path becomes selected when you have deleted a point and a second click will delete the rest of the path.

  • Diffrence between Measuring point and Counter

    What is the difference between Measuring Point and Counter ?
    -Md

    Hi,
    _Measuring Point_
    Measuring points in the SAP System describe the physical locations at which a condition is described, (for example, Temparature and Pressure on a Boiler ). The characteristics associated with the measuring points which record the value can only be numeric characteristic. Measuring points are located on technical objects, in other words, on pieces of equipment or functional locations. For every measuring point there should be some characteristics to measure the reading.
    To enable you to differentiate more easily between the individual measuring points and provide them with a unit, you assign each measuring point to a characteristic.
    The parameters like Running Hours, Temperature, Pressure etc,, on equipments can also be mapped under measuring point.
    Counter:
    A type of measuring point, where a continuous reading is recorded (e.g. Milometer). In case the measuring point is a counter, it needs to be defined likewise.
    Counter readings are taken at counters at particular intervals and in particular measurement units.
    For Example, counter readings for kilometers driven or electricity used
